AI Technical Summary

Technical Problem

Existing digital customer service systems, lacking voice and video input, rely solely on text content for emotion analysis, resulting in low accuracy and an inability to effectively capture users' true emotional states. This is especially problematic in high-density crowds where they cannot distinguish between shared and unshared anxieties, leading to mismatched service responses and a reduced user experience.

Method used

By using text-based user intent recognition and emotion contagion models, combined with spatial distance weighting functions, the influence of individual and group emotions is calculated. A two-stage emotion assessment mechanism is designed to distinguish the contagion weights of common and non-common anxieties, thus compensating for the shortcomings of emotion recognition under a single text modality.

Benefits of technology

In privacy-protected scenarios, it improves the accuracy of emotion recognition and the quality of service response, and can accurately compensate for users' emotional assessment when multimodal input is lacking. It significantly enhances the emotional perception ability of digital customer service, especially in providing timely and effective reassurance and solutions in the event of emergencies.

Abstract

The present application relates to the technical field of user emotion recognition in digital customer service, in particular to a user emotion recognition method based on text information, medium and equipment. The method comprises the following steps: determining the influence period and range of emotion contagion based on the current time and location; combining the basic emotion score and the emotion score of other users meeting the conditions to calculate the comprehensive negative emotion value. The formula considers the emotion score of other users, spatial distance weight and intention weight, and the high anxiety common intention weight is higher. The present application accurately models the emotion contagion effect through the spatial distance weight function, distinguishes the contagion weight of common and non-common anxiety, improves the accuracy of emotion evaluation under single text mode, assigns higher weight to common anxiety events, and enhances the emotion contagion effect. Its influence will be significantly amplified, thereby compensating for the underestimation of the target user's emotion caused by single text input.
